The EO/IR Solutions (EOIRS) International products Finance team is seeking a highly motivated Finance lead to join our group.  This role is primarily responsible for, but not limited to: Assisting in Annual Operating Plans, financial forecasting and reporting, variance analysis, Earned Value Management and compliance, Estimates at Completion (EACs), cash management, capital/company funded requests, and ROI analysis. You will have the ability to work independently, be self-motivated, and comfortable with new challenges and multiple competing priorities.  Strong communication skills are also required, along with the ability to effectively interact with multiple layers within the organization and to make recommendations for appropriate solutions.

What You Will Do:

Support the monthly financial planning forecast / close process (Rplan).Develop and support Quarterly Estimate-at-Completion (EAC) / monthly Latest Revised Estimate (LRE) development.PRISM analysis including analysis and update of MRP drives, impacts of Grouping/Pegging/Distribution, and Material analysis.Provide financial guidance to Factory Operations Managers, IPT leads, and SCM functions.Communication of forecast commitments to program team and communication of risk and opportunities to that plan to program leadership.Provide weekly, monthly, and quarterly variance and data analysis.Provide cost, schedule, financial analysis/reporting, funding planning, maintenance and reporting utilizing standard company tools and processes.Review EAC inputs, presentations, and proposals for accuracy and completeness.Review and analysis of EVM, Funding, and monthly status report Contract Data Requirements List (CDRLs).

Qualifications You Must Have: 

Typically requires: A Bachelor’s degree in Finance, Accounting, or related discipline or equivalent experience and minimum 5 years prior relevant experience, or An Advanced Degree in a related field and minimum 3 years experience.Experience interfacing and conducting business with various functional disciplines (Contracts, Operations, Engineering, etc).Experience analyzing data and information necessary to ensure portfolio performance to plan and to ensure that problem areas are identified and corrective action is taken.Experience managing multiple priorities and influence in a matrix organization.Proficient computer software skills in MS Office - Excel, PowerPoint and Word.The ability to obtain and maintain a U.S. government issued security clearance is required. U.S. citizenship is required, as only U.S. citizens are eligible for a security clearance.

Qualifications We Prefer:

Working knowledge of SAP, APEX EV, Business Warehouse.GovCon/Defense industry experience with knowledge of both government accounting techniques and Sarbanes-Oxley compliance processes; domestically and internationally.Experience with large, complex date analytics.Experience in Financial Planning and Analysis.Excellent communication skills (written and oral) to support the preparation and presentation of written briefs and summaries for internal/external dissemination.
